Metro Police standoff in downtown Las Vegas ends with man in custody

Updated Wednesday, April 12, 2017 | 3:37 p.m.

Metro Police say a wanted man who barricaded himself in a downtown Las Vegas residence for several hours today has been taken into custody.

Officers, including members of the Metro SWAT team, responded to the home in the 300 block of 14th Street, police said. Nearby homes were not been evacuated, but the street was closed, police said.

The man was taken into custody without further incident about 3 p.m., police said.

Police did not provide any additional information.
